﻿
/* CSS Document */


A.listtext
{
	font-size: 13px;
	color: #0C5685;
	font-family: Arial, Helvetica, sans-serif;
	
	text-decoration: none;
}
A.listtext:hover
{
	font-size: 13px;
	color: #000000;
	font-family: Arial, Helvetica, sans-serif;
	
	text-decoration: none;
}

.search_title_bg{background:url(images/PM/recent_bg.jpg) repeat-x; height:36px; width:998px; -webkit-border-top-left-radius: 4px; -webkit-border-top-right-radius: 4px; -moz-border-radius-topleft: 4px;
-moz-border-radius-topright: 4px; border-top-left-radius: 4px; border-top-right-radius: 4px; border:1px solid #d1e5f4;}
.search_title_bg .left{color:#d53c03; font-size:18px; text-transform:uppercase; height:24px; padding-left:20px;  float:left; top:5px; position:relative;}
.search_title_bg .right{height:24px; padding-left:20px; color:#2e2d2d; font-weight:bold; font-size:13px; width:450px; float:right; text-align:right; right:15px;}
.searchtable{margin-right:0px; margin-bottom:25px; -webkit-border-bottom-right-radius: 4px; -webkit-border-bottom-left-radius: 4px; -moz-border-radius-bottomright: 4px; -moz-border-radius-bottomleft: 4px;
border-bottom-right-radius: 4px; border-bottom-left-radius: 4px; border:1px solid #d1e5f4;}

.clr{clear:both;}

.commontable{width:100%; margin-right:0px; margin-bottom:25px; -webkit-border-bottom-right-radius: 4px; -webkit-border-bottom-left-radius: 4px; -moz-border-radius-bottomright: 4px; -moz-border-radius-bottomleft: 4px;
border-bottom-right-radius: 4px; border-bottom-left-radius: 4px; border:1px solid #d1e5f4;}
.commontable .left{width:150px; color:#333333; font-size:15px; height:30px; padding:5px 5px 5px 100px;  float:left; top:5px; position:relative; text-align:left;}
.commontable .right{height:30px; padding:5px; color:#2e2d2d; font-weight:bold; font-size:13px; width:400px; float:right; text-align:left; right:15px;}

/*.field{border:1px solid #d4d4d4; background-color:#FFF; padding-left:5px; height:23px;}
.field_head{width:150px; float:left; color:#0086be;}
.field_space{padding:0 0 15px 0;}

.button{height:25px; background-color:#333; color:#FFF; font-size:14px; display:block; padding:10px 20px;}*/

.result{background:url(../images/searchtable_bg2.jpg) repeat-x; height:30px; padding:5px;}
.result .left{width:580px; float:left; top:-3px;}
.result .right{width:380px; float:right; text-align:right; position:relative; top:-3px;}
.result .full{width:100%; top:-3px;}
.result .totalpages li{float:left; list-style:none; padding:5px; display:block;}
.result .totalbtn li{float:left; list-style:none; padding-right:5px; border:1px solid #d1e5f4;}


.pageresult{background:url(images/searchtable_bg2.jpg) repeat-x; height:30px; padding:5px;}
.pageresult .navbar {color:#000000; margin-top:3px;}
.pageresult .navbar li{float:left; list-style:none; padding:2px; display:block;}
.pageresult .navbar a{margin-top:-3px; padding:2px 6px 2px 6px; display:block; background-color:#a6c7f0; border:1px solid #83ace0; color:#12345f; display:inline-block; font-family:calibri, arial; font-size:13px; -moz-box-shadow: inset 0 0 5px #94b8e5; -webkit-box-shadow: inset 0 0 5px #94b8e5; box-shadow: inset 0 0 5px #94b8e5; -moz-border-radius:3px; -webkit-border-radius:3px; border-radius:3px;}
.pageresult .navbar li .span{float:left; margin:0 5px 0 15px;}
.pageresult .navbar a:hover{margin-top:-3px; padding:2px 6px 2px 6px; display:block; background-color:#6f9eda; border:1px solid #83ace0; color:#ffffff; display:inline-block; font-family:calibri, arial; font-size:13px; -moz-box-shadow: inset 0 0 5px #94b8e5; -webkit-box-shadow: inset 0 0 5px #94b8e5; box-shadow: inset 0 0 5px #94b8e5; -moz-border-radius:3px; -webkit-border-radius:3px; border-radius:3px;}
.pageresult .navbar .active{margin-top:-3px; padding:2px 6px 2px 6px; display:block; background-color:#6f9eda; border:1px solid #83ace0; color:#ffffff; display:inline-block; font-family:calibri, arial; font-size:13px; -moz-box-shadow: inset 0 0 5px #94b8e5; -webkit-box-shadow: inset 0 0 5px #94b8e5; box-shadow: inset 0 0 5px #94b8e5; -moz-border-radius:3px; -webkit-border-radius:3px; border-radius:3px;}
.pageresult .navbar .button{margin-top:-3px; padding:1px 4px 1px 4px; display:block; background-color:#a6c7f0; border:1px solid #83ace0; color:#12345f; display:inline-block; font-family:calibri, arial; font-size:13px; -moz-box-shadow: inset 0 0 5px #94b8e5; -webkit-box-shadow: inset 0 0 5px #94b8e5; box-shadow: inset 0 0 5px #94b8e5; -moz-border-radius:3px; -webkit-border-radius:3px; border-radius:3px;}
.pageresult .navbar .button:hover{margin-top:-3px; padding:1px 4px 1px 4px; display:block; background-color:#6f9eda; border:1px solid #83ace0; color:#ffffff; display:inline-block; font-family:calibri, arial; font-size:13px; -moz-box-shadow: inset 0 0 5px #94b8e5; -webkit-box-shadow: inset 0 0 5px #94b8e5; box-shadow: inset 0 0 5px #94b8e5; -moz-border-radius:3px; -webkit-border-radius:3px; border-radius:3px;}



/*order search */
.search{/*background-color:#fafafa;*/ width:960px; padding:20px 20px 0 20px; height:auto; font-size:14px;}
.search .left_tab{width:500px; float:left; height:auto; }
.search .left_tab .title{ color:#000000; padding-bottom:20px;}
.search .left_tab .tree_menu{color:#000; width:420; background-color:#FFF; border:1px solid #e1e1e1; padding:15px 15px;}
.search .right_tab{float:right; width:450px; height:auto; padding-bottom:20px;}
.search .right_tab .title{ color:#000000; padding-bottom:20px;}
.search .right_tab .tree_menu{color:#000; width:420; background-color:#FFF; border:1px solid #e1e1e1; padding:15px 15px;}

.inside_content{width:950px; padding:5px 0 5px 0;}
.inside_heading{height:39px; background-color:#919191;} 

.news_details_title{background:url(images/PM/search_title_bg.jpg) repeat-x; height:36px; width:650px;}
.news_details_title .left{background:url(images/PM/title_bullet.jpg) no-repeat 2px; height:24px; padding-left:5px; color:#005d84; font-weight:bold; font-size:16px; width:350px; float:left; top:5px; position:relative; left:5px;}
.news_details_title .right{height:24px; padding-left:5px; color:#2e2d2d; font-weight:bold; font-size:13px; width:230px; float:right; text-align:right; right:5px;}

.news_details{padding-bottom:10px; /*border-bottom:1px dotted #e1e1e1;*/ font-size:15px; text-align:justify;}
.news_details h1{font-size:20px; font-weight:normal; width:600px; height:25px; color:#dd4e4e; padding:10px 10px 10px 0; border-bottom:1px dotted #dddddd;}
.news_details .date{color:#8b8b8b; font-size:13px; padding:5px 0 5px 0; float:left; width:200px;}
.news_details .icons{color:#8b8b8b; font-style:italic; padding:5px 0 5px 0; float:right; width:300px; text-align:right;}
.news_details .dis{color:#575757; font-size:15px; text-align:justify;}
.news_details p{padding:2px 2px 2px 2px; font-size:15px; text-align:justify;}

.news_details_left{width:650px; float:left;}
.news_details_right{width:290px; float:right;}

.default_news {background: url("Images/PM/recent_bg.jpg") repeat-x scroll 0 0 transparent;border: 1px solid #D1E5F4;border-radius: 4px 4px 4px 4px;float: left;height: 220px;margin-bottom: 25px;margin-right: 0;margin-top: 0;margin-left: 0;padding: 5px 5px 5px 5px;width: 280px;}
.default_news .more a{color:#222222; border:1px solid #ddb94e; margin-left:15px; padding:2px 10px 2px 10px; background-color:#fbdb00; text-decoration:none; text-transform:uppercase; -webkit-border-radius: 3px; -moz-border-radius: 3px; border-radius: 3px;}
.default_news .more a:hover{ color:#222222; border:1px solid #ddb94e; margin-left:15px; padding:2px 10px 2px 10px; background-color:#fbb700; text-decoration:none; text-transform:uppercase; -webkit-border-radius: 3px; -moz-border-radius: 3px; border-radius: 3px;}
.default_news .list li{background-image:url("images/PM/small_right_arrow.png"); background-repeat:no-repeat; list-style:none; padding-left:5px; margin-top:-6px;padding-top:9px; margin-left:5px; color:#0357af; font-size:13px;}
.default_news .list li a{color:#0357af; font-size:14px; text-decoration:none; }
.default_news .list li a:hover{color:#000000; font-size:14px; text-decoration:none;}
.default_news .list li a:visited{color:#0357af; font-size:14px; text-decoration:none;}
.default_news_scroll{ height:200px; width:280px; margin-top:20px; margin-bottom:10px; padding-right:5px;}

.sectionhead{color:#d53c03; font-size:18px; text-transform:uppercase; padding-top:2px;}

.black_overlay
        {
            display: none;
            position: absolute;
            top: 0%;
            left: 0%;
            width: 100%;
            height: 250%;
            background-color: #EBECE4;
            z-index: 1001;
            -moz-opacity: 0.8;
            opacity: .30;
            filter: alpha(opacity=80);
        }
        
        .white_content
        {
            display: none;
            position: absolute;
            top: 37px;
            left: 22%;
            width: 50%;
            height: auto;
            padding: 16px;
            z-index: 1002;            
        }
        
.greysmall
{
	font-weight: normal;
	font-size: 10px;
	color: #555555;
	font-family: arial, tahoma, verdana;
}






 .table2
    {
        border: 1px solid #ebe4c7;
        background-color: #ffffff;
        width: 100%;
    }
    
    
    .table2 td, .table2 th
    {
        padding: 5px;
        color: #555555;
    }
    
    .table2 .year
    {
        font-size: 20px;
        color: #CC0000;
        padding-left:20px;
        background-color:#f7f5de;
    }
    
    .table2 .left
    {
        padding: 5px;
        color: #222222;
        background-color:#f7f5de;
    }
    .table2 .heading1
    {
        font-size: 20px;
        color: #CC0000;
    }
    .table2 .heading2
    {
        font-size: 17px;
        font-weight: bold;
    }
    .table2 a
    {
        color: #286fb8;
        text-decoration: none;
        /*border-bottom: 1px dotted;*/
    }
    
       .table2 a.digital
    {
        color: #286fb8;
        text-decoration: none;
        background-image:url(../images/login_page_bg.jpg) repeat;
        height:50px;}
        /*border-bottom: 1px dotted;*/
    }
    .table2 th
    {
        font-family: Calibri;
        font-size: 16px;
        line-height: 20px;
        font-style: normal;
        font-weight: normal;
        text-align: left;
        text-shadow: white 1px 1px 1px;
        color: #222222;
        background-color: #fffff9;
        border: 1px solid #f1ecd6;
    }
    .table2 td
    {
        line-height: 20px;
        font-family: calibri;
        font-size: 15px;
        border-top: 1px solid #f1ecd6;
    }
    .table2 td:hover
    {
        background-color: #f7f5de;
    }

.table2 .survey_head
    {
        background-color: #f7f5de;
    }


/* Table css end */



/* Pagination For Listview In Dashboard */
.DataPager1
{
	border: 0;
	margin: 0;
	padding: 0;
	font-size: 12px;
	list-style: none;
	float: left;
}

.DataPager1 a
{
	border: solid 1px #EBE5D9;
	margin-right: 2px;
}

.DataPager1 .command
{
	font-weight: bold;
	display: block;
	float: left;
	margin-right: 2px;
	padding: 3px 4px;
}

.DataPager1 .current
{
	background: #523A0B;
	color: #FFFFFF;
	font-weight: bold;
	display: block;
	float: left;
	padding: 4px 6px;
	margin-right: 2px;
	border: 1px solid #d9cbad;
}
.DataPager1 .next
{
	background: #EBE5D9;
	color: Black;
	display: block;
	float: left;
	padding: 4px 6px;
	margin-right: 2px;
	border: 1px solid #d9cbad;
}
.DataPager1 a:link, .DataPager1 a:visited
{
	display: block;
	float: left;
	padding: 3px 6px;
	text-decoration: none;
}

.DataPager1 a:hover
{
	border: solid 1px #EBE5D9;
}


/* Accordion */
.accordionHeader
{
	border: 1px solid #d9cbad;
	color: white;
	background-color: #e9c174;
	font-family: Arial, Sans-Serif;
	font-size: 12px;
	font-weight: bold;
	padding: 5px;
	margin-top: 5px;
	cursor: pointer;
}

#master_content .accordionHeader a
{
	background: none;
	text-decoration: none;
}

#master_content .accordionHeader a:hover
{
	background: none;
	text-decoration: underline;
}

.accordionHeaderSelected
{
	border: 1px solid #d9cbad;
	color: white;
	background-color: #e0b665;
	font-family: Arial, Sans-Serif;
	font-size: 12px;
	font-weight: bold;
	padding: 5px;
	margin-top: 5px;
	cursor: pointer;
}

#master_content .accordionHeaderSelected a
{
	color: #FFFFFF;
	background: none;
	text-decoration: none;
}

#master_content .accordionHeaderSelected a:hover
{
	background: none;
	text-decoration: underline;
}

.accordionContent
{
	/* background-color: #D3DEEF;*/
	background-color: #FFFFFF;
	border: 1px dashed #2F4F4F;
	border-top: none;
	padding: 5px;
	padding-top: 10px;
}

.accordionContent1
{
	/* background-color: #D3DEEF;*/
	background-color: #FFFFFF;
	border: 1px dashed #2F4F4F;
	border-top: none;
	padding: 5px;
	padding-top: 10px;
}


